Breaststroke Rule Change
Rule 101.1 Breaststroke
Kick - After the start and each turn, a single downward butterfly
kick followed by a breaststroke kick is
permitted while wholly submerged. Following which, all movements of the legs
shall be simultaneously
and in the same horizontal plane without alternating movement.
Rule Interpretation -
The official interpretation for the changes to the breaststroke is
that during, or at the end of the arm pull-down
of the first stroke after the start and after each turn, a single downward
butterfly kick is allowed, but not required, followed by a breaststroke
kick. During the pull-down, if a downward butterfly kick is taken, it must
be followed
by a breaststroke kick. It is not permissible to take only a downward
butterfly kick without then taking a normal breaststroke kick. The downward
butterfly kick is not permissible prior to the arm pull-down. In
addition,
there
is now a requirement for all movements of the legs to be “in the same
horizontal plane and without
alternating movement”.
